A Monolithic High‐G SOI‐MEMS Accelerometer for Measuring Projectile Launch and Flight Accelerations
Analog Devices (ADI) has designed and fabricated a monolithic high‐g acceleration sensor (ADXSTC3‐HG) fabricated with the ADI silicon‐on‐insulator micro‐electro‐mechanical system (SOI‐MEMS) process. The SOI‐MEMS sensor structure has a thickness of 10 um, allowing for the design of inertial sensors with excellent cross‐axis rejection.

Soy, Soy Phytoestrogens and Cardiovascular Disease [PDF]
Dietary soy protein has been shown to have several beneficial effects on cardiovascular health. The best-documented effect is on plasma lipid and lipoprotein concentrations, with reductions of approximately 10% in LDL cholesterol concentrations (somewhat greater for individuals with high pretreatment LDL cholesterol concentrations) and small increases ...
